According to local Iranian media reports, Iranian police have confiscated about 45,000 Bitcoin mining machines that illegally used subsidized electricity. Mohammad Hassan Motavalizadeh, head of Iran's state-owned power company Tavanir, said that these miners consumed 95 megawatts of electricity per hour at super cheap prices, and the total consumption was equivalent to the electricity use of a city with a population of more than 500,000. |
